- 博客(1)
- 收藏
- 关注
原创 oracle 主键和外键的区别
合理的数据结构设计,表中的数据一定有一致性约束,使用外键,让数据库去约束数据的一致,不给任何人出错的机会。不用也不会怎么样,如果不用外键,在程序中要写代码进行判断,手工操作数据时也必须处处小心。外键(foreign key)是用于表达两个表数据之间的关系,将表中主键字段添加到另一个表中,再创建两个表之间的约束关系,这些字段就成为第二个表的外键。2、外键:表的外键是另一表的主键, 外键可以有重复的, 可以是空值;一个表可以有多个外键。修改从表的记录时,如果外键的值在主表中不存在,阻止修改。
2022-11-03 16:20:52 796
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人